Right rear seat unlocked

Wondering if anyone has seen this error before. I have the 3rd row option and have raised and lowered the 3rd (and 2nd for that matter) seat several times, but the error remains.

Seemed to happen when one of my passengers adjusted the 2nd row seat whilst the 3rd row was folded down. Seen someone in the F15 forum comment that the sensors are super sensitive and that it happened to them in the same manner. Their fix was to raise and lower the 3rd row, but that doesn't seem to be working for me. The 3rd row doesn't seem to "lock" down, but it does "lock" up.

This is what happens when it stops mid-cycle - basically jams up the front row and the middle. You need to let it go all the way back to the start of the cycle (so the switch on the side) - front row moves forward, back etc and then once it has clicked back into place fully you can press the switch again to move things forward again (or vice versa depending on where you are in the cycle).

Issue is you can have noone in the middle seat and the third row people need to breathe in while you do this. Kids seats come out if you put it in. It's a headache but when you get used to what a complete cycle looks like then you wait before people get in, child seat is installed etc

Fixed

Quick update.

All seats were latching and locking properly. Tech at the dealership fixed the right rear by re-initializing it, then whilst testing everything the left one created the same message. Long and short is that the tech initialized ALL of the seats and things seem to be good so far.

Only downside is that the seat memory for the fronts was wiped too. No biggie since I've been fiddling with them almost weekly so far.
